Vivia AlternativesVideo Editors and other similar apps like Vivia

Vivia is described as 'Video editing program for Linux and Windows that offers very user-friendly editing of DV video material. Vivia is Free Software with a GPL license' and is a Video Editor in the video & movies category. There are more than 25 alternatives to Vivia for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Mac, Web-based, Linux and iPhone apps. The best Vivia alternative is Kdenlive, which is both free and Open Source. Other great apps like Vivia are Shotcut, DaVinci Resolve, OpenShot and Avidemux.

    Linear video editor supporting basic cutting, filtering, encoding, batch scripting, and many formats; ideal for single-file edits, trimming, re-encoding, and simple cleanup but not for multi-track or montage projects requiring nonlinear editing capabilities.
